#include using namespace std; int main(){ long long v, t, p, ok, ng = 1ll << 60, mid; cin >> v >> t >> p; while(ok + 1 < ng){ mid = (ok + ng) >> 1; //mid mLの鼻水が出る //(mid + t - 1)/ t mLだけすすることができる //v * p mL だけ除去できる if(v * p + (mid + t - 1) / t + v >= mid)ok = mid; else ng = mid; } cout << ok << endl; }